True To Minnesota And All It Stands For
The introduction of a new color palette, positioning of the matured and iconic wolf, a basketball in its background along with the implementation of the North Star, the Timberwolves new logo visually represents the team’s direction more than ever.
The primary marks come together to unleash a modern and sleek design with hints of core Minnesota characteristics.

Team Rune
The Team Rune "A" is a representative piece of the history of the wolf and the state of Minnesota.

North Star
The North Star is incorporated into the Timberwolves logo because it represents one of the pillars we proudly hang our hat on – the state of Minnesota. Minnesotans are loyal, strong and have a hard-working heritage. The element of the star in our logo represents our Minnesota pride.

Direction
The Timberwolves, as a team have a lot to be proud of. Admirable owners, successful playoff runs, talented alumni, and so much more. The direction of the wolf is facing forward because we want to honor the past we are proud of, without forgetting it. Our organization is constantly moving ahead and carving out new territory. We want to leave the frustrating years behind us and more on to a hopeful future – a New Era.

Green of the Eyes
Greenery surrounds us every day in Minnesota. Whether it is the northern lights in the sky, the reflection of ice crystals in the winter, or the buildings we work around, the green eyes of the wolf are another representation of the fierceness of Minnesota. Green is also a sign of spring. In the spring, the buds of the trees flourish as a bright green. The green in our color palette represents a new era of what is to come.

Breaking Out
The wolf breaks out of the circle represents the wolf’s ability to fight through discouraging times and come out on top. Our players often show traits of not being able to contain their strength. Whether it is going up for a dunk, a steal, fast break, or cheering moment – the energy of our players is uncontainable.

Midnight Blue
Reminiscent of the midnight forest sky that darkens the domain of wolves when their instincts are heightened and their hunting prowess elevated. The hue stands as a dominant and primary color to be utilized throughout all things Timberwolves.
Aurora Green
Inspired by the motion and the vibrance of the Northern Lights, one of the most astounding sights in the northland - Aurora Green introduces a hue that is symbolic to our stomping grounds but is new to the Timberwolves brand.
Frost White
This singular color embodies the resilient and bold nature of this great frozen land. Each element that consists of a Frost White hue is representative of our state’s weather and our instinct to thrive in all conditions.
Moonlight Grey
Recalling the silver light of Luna that serves as an unwavering beacon of our ever-growing pack, Moonlight Grey shines bright as a prominent color within the new identity.
Lake Blue
Lake Blue captures the depths of the 10,000 lakes that span across the state of Minnesota. The shade creatively illustrates the prominence of our great bodies of water and holds its place as a notable option within our palette.
